タグ

2020年8月7日のブックマーク (3件)

  • WSLコンソールのコピペ方法まとめ(Vim,Tmux) - Qiita

    bash on Cmderからzsh on WSLコンソールへ乗り換え ここ数年、Windows10でシェルを使うときはcmderでbashを使っていたのですが、最近はWSL(Windows Subsystem for Liux)を使っています。WSLだと普通にLinuxが使えるので、zshも楽々インストールできるし、Python環境もAnacondaに縛られなくてもよくなるし、もはや、Linuxを使うためにMacを買う必要なんてありませんね。 でも、WSLが利用できるデフォルトのコンソール(WSLコンソール)は、コマンドプロンプトをベースにした、非常にシンプルなもので、正直使いづらい。。 たいていの人はcmderなどのエミュレータからWSLを使っているかと思うのですが、cmder+WSL+Tmuxで使うと、マウスでペインの操作ができなかったり、ステータスバーの更新がうまく表示されなかった

    WSLコンソールのコピペ方法まとめ(Vim,Tmux) - Qiita
    tsuyossii
    tsuyossii 2020/08/07
  • Symfony 2.7入門 その1 インストールとHello World · DQNEO日記

    Symfony 2.7入門です。 Symfonyは、現在のPHPフレームワークの中で最も使われているものの1つです。 特徴としては、 徹底した疎結合の設計思想 部品の再利用性が高い ソースコードが読みやすい 世界的にユーザが多い 柔軟性が高い などがあるかと思います。 個人的な感想としては上記に加えて 「クセが少ない」というのがあると思います。つまり汎用的であるということです。 Symfonyで学んだ知識や哲学は、他のフレームワークや他の言語で開発するときにもきっと役にたつことでしょう。 想定読者と推奨環境 PHPは少し使えるけどSymfonyは初めてという方を対象にしています。 Linux/Unixの基的なコマンドは使えることを想定しています。 動作環境はLinux及びMacです。(Windowsの方はVagrant等の仮想環境を使ってください) PHP5.4以上のバージョンを推奨しま

    Symfony 2.7入門 その1 インストールとHello World · DQNEO日記
    tsuyossii
    tsuyossii 2020/08/07
  • composer.json、composer.lockって何なの?という人向けのまとめ - Qiita

    { "require" : { "facebook/php-sdk" : "4.0.*" }, "require-dev": { "phpunit/phpunit": "3.7.*" } } requireについて 依存をパッケージ名:バージョンで指定する バージョンは"1.0.*"のようなワイルドカードなどが使える require-devについて 開発時のみに依存するパッケージを書く 依存するパッケージをインストールする composer installを実行する composer.jsonを元に依存解決し、パッケージのダウンロードを行いvendor/に配置される composer.lockというファイルが同階層にない場合はダウンロードしたパッケージのバージョン情報を書き出す。 composer.lockを更新したい場合はcomposer updateを使う composer.lockに

    composer.json、composer.lockって何なの?という人向けのまとめ - Qiita
    tsuyossii
    tsuyossii 2020/08/07